Premium Economy, World Traveller Plus, Economy Plus. All these products offer more or less similar services - more leg room and seat width without the huge price of business/first.
But yet only a very small number of airlines offer these services. In fact many Airports across the US have absolutely no airlines flying in with premium economy.
Now this just confuses me. So you take one row of seats out of your aircraft, increase the legroom for the 6x rows behind it, and split the cost equally (with a small mark-up).
The airlines gain:
- Passengers shopping for Economy+ Seats (including tall, large, or comfort seeking)
- No fuel cost on the missing row's bags (even though you're charging the equivalent of fuel cost to the six rows)
- Less passenger/seat weight (the missing row doesn't weight anything)
- No insurance cost of that missing row
- More repeat business
Discount Economy = $1000
Economy+ = ($1000 * 1.166) = $1166
Discount Economy Legroom = 31" (pitch)
Economy+ = 36"
